nedoPC.org

Electronics hobbyists community established in 2002
Atom Feed | View unanswered posts | View active topics It is currently 28 Mar 2024 11:21



Reply to topic  [ 413 posts ]  Go to page Previous  1 ... 21, 22, 23, 24, 25, 26, 27, 28  Next
nedoPC-580 (SMP на 5 процессорах КР580ВМ80А) 
Author Message
Senior
User avatar

Joined: 09 Aug 2012 11:20
Posts: 176
Location: 95.135.174.189
Reply with quote
Post 
Shaos, а можно хотя бы приблизительный набросок схемы этого чуда?

_________________
Хочу стать всезнайкой ;-)


09 Dec 2012 06:19
Profile
Admin
User avatar

Joined: 08 Jan 2003 23:22
Posts: 22411
Location: Silicon Valley
Reply with quote
Post 
He3HauKo wrote:
Shaos, а можно хотя бы приблизительный набросок схемы этого чуда?


HardWareMan набросал заготовочку в сентябре прошлого года - находится на 11 странице этого топика:

http://www.nedopc.org/forum/viewtopic.p ... &start=153

_________________
:dj: https://mastodon.social/@Shaos


09 Dec 2012 08:15
Profile WWW
Senior
User avatar

Joined: 09 Aug 2012 11:20
Posts: 176
Location: 95.135.174.189
Reply with quote
Post 
Quote:
HardWareMan набросал заготовочку в сентябре прошлого года - находится на 11 странице этого топика:
http://www.nedopc.org/forum/viewtopic.p ... &start=153


Это я видал, здесь все отлично!
Интересует следующие.
Проц он ведь не за один такт читает/пишет.

Если я все правильно понял, каждый из процов будет в свое время подключатся к общей шине, и к примеру, запись в память будет выглядеть так.
При первом получении шины он выставит АДРЕС;
При 2-м сигнал обращения к памяти;
При 3-м выставляются Даные;
И 4-м подается сигнал WR

Так вот вопрос, он всегдабудет подключен к шине или только в время появления сигналов RD/WR?

_________________
Хочу стать всезнайкой ;-)


09 Dec 2012 09:06
Profile
Banned
User avatar

Joined: 20 Mar 2005 13:41
Posts: 2141
Location: От туда
Reply with quote
Post 
He3HauKo wrote:
Интересует следующие.
Проц он ведь не за один такт читает/пишет.

Если я все правильно понял, каждый из процов будет в свое время подключатся к общей шине, и к примеру, запись в память будет выглядеть так.
При первом получении шины он выставит АДРЕС;
При 2-м сигнал обращения к памяти;
При 3-м выставляются Даные;
И 4-м подается сигнал WR

Так вот вопрос, он всегдабудет подключен к шине или только в время появления сигналов RD/WR?

В течение всего своего таймслота. В общем, все уже украдено, до нас. ;)


Last edited by HardWareMan on 05 Jan 2014 06:57, edited 1 time in total.



09 Dec 2012 09:30
Profile
Supreme God
User avatar

Joined: 21 Oct 2009 08:08
Posts: 7777
Location: Россия
Reply with quote
Post 
Shaos wrote:
Про подвешивание второго проца, пока первый елозит по общей памяти - это не сюда
Тут у нас полностью прозрачное обращение к памяти обоих процов одновременно...

Да неужели?! :o А топикстартер об этом ничего не говорил... :wink:
А вот волюнтаристское переименование топика в SMP на 5 процессорах 8080 -
очень странный шаг...
cr0acker wrote:
Предполгается что система с 48 процессорами...

Вот это и есть иллюстрация к знаменитому афоризму Козьмы Пруткова: 8)
Quote:
«Если на клетке слона прочтешь надпись: «буйвол»,— не верь глазам своим!»

_________________
iLavr


09 Dec 2012 13:07
Profile
Admin
User avatar

Joined: 08 Jan 2003 23:22
Posts: 22411
Location: Silicon Valley
Reply with quote
Post 
Топик с годами эволюционировал в достаточно железобетонную идею - будем её придерживаться!

P.S. В отличие от некоторых я первые посты топиков в последствии не переделываю...

_________________
:dj: https://mastodon.social/@Shaos


09 Dec 2012 14:05
Profile WWW
Supreme God
User avatar

Joined: 21 Oct 2009 08:08
Posts: 7777
Location: Россия
Reply with quote
Post 
Shaos wrote:
В отличие от некоторых я первые посты топиков в последствии не переделываю...

А зря - на дружественном форуме основные полезные мысли выносят на первую страницу...
Чтобы всяк вошедший - оценил, а надо ли читать ему остальные бредни, и переливания
из пустого в порожнее... :wink:



PS. В отличие от некоторых, ты вручную переделываешь и то, что движок форума не позволяет...
Это когда тебе вожжа под хвост попадёт...
:lol:

_________________
iLavr


09 Dec 2012 14:16
Profile
Admin
User avatar

Joined: 08 Jan 2003 23:22
Posts: 22411
Location: Silicon Valley
Reply with quote
Post 
Lavr wrote:
Да неужели?! :o А топикстартер об этом ничего не говорил... :wink:
А вот волюнтаристское переименование топика в SMP на 5 процессорах 8080 -
очень странный шаг...
cr0acker wrote:
Предполгается что система с 48 процессорами...


Кстати никто не мешает объединить 10 nedoPC-580 в сеть и получить 50 процов total :roll:

P.S. Если посмотреть парой постов ниже, то можно увидеть:
Shaos wrote:
- предлагаю начать с простейшей модели из 5 процессоров

_________________
:dj: https://mastodon.social/@Shaos


09 Dec 2012 14:46
Profile WWW
Admin
User avatar

Joined: 08 Jan 2003 23:22
Posts: 22411
Location: Silicon Valley
Reply with quote
Post 
Схема в которой два 8080 разделяют общую память, обращение к которой одного проца тормозит второй - бессмысленна, т.к. у 8080 кешей нету, в каждом машинном цикле происходит один или более обращений по шине - соответственно из двух процов один будет ПОЧТИ ВСЕГДА стоять - какой смысл на эту схему вообще даже смотреть?

_________________
:dj: https://mastodon.social/@Shaos


09 Dec 2012 15:19
Profile WWW
Supreme God
User avatar

Joined: 21 Oct 2009 08:08
Posts: 7777
Location: Россия
Reply with quote
Post 
Shaos wrote:
Схема в которой два 8080 разделяют общую память, обращение к которой одного проца тормозит второй - бессмысленна, т.к. у 8080 кешей нету, в каждом машинном цикле происходит один или более обращений по шине - соответственно из двух процов один будет ПОЧТИ ВСЕГДА стоять - какой смысл на эту схему вообще даже смотреть?

Вот тут ты и попал пальцем в небо, поскольку схему не видел, и высказываешь
абстрактные заблуждения.

Но я не навязываю ничего. Мне схема понравилась. Своей конкретностью.
И простотой. Как программной, так и аппаратной.

Я подожду ещё страниц 20... Глядишь и здесь схема какая-либо появится - будет
с чем сравнить... :wink:



PS. Если только не лет 20... лет 20 - я не подожду... :lol:

_________________
iLavr


09 Dec 2012 15:33
Profile
Admin
User avatar

Joined: 08 Jan 2003 23:22
Posts: 22411
Location: Silicon Valley
Reply with quote
Post 
Ну ты же сам писал:

Quote:
Арбитр шины 74F786 – служит для распределения времени доступа к системной шине. Входные запросы формируются из сигналов чтения/записи памяти, поступающих от системных контроллеров. Выходы разрешения BG подключены к входам BUSEN системных контроллеров, что позволяет подключать локальные шины данных процессоров к памяти в нужный момент. Так же эти сигналы, пройдя через инвертор, попадают на вход READY процессоров, что дает возможность подождать, пока доступ к памяти не будет разрешен.


По моему всё и так ясно - можно даже не смотреть...

_________________
:dj: https://mastodon.social/@Shaos


09 Dec 2012 15:56
Profile WWW
Supreme God
User avatar

Joined: 21 Oct 2009 08:08
Posts: 7777
Location: Россия
Reply with quote
Post 
Shaos wrote:
По моему всё и так ясно - можно даже не смотреть...

Да ну ты не смотри - я тебе смотреть и не предлагал... :lol:

Лучше нарисуй тогда, чтобы я посмотрел, не 20 страниц и не 20 лет спустя!... :wink:

_________________
iLavr


09 Dec 2012 16:01
Profile
Admin
User avatar

Joined: 08 Jan 2003 23:22
Posts: 22411
Location: Silicon Valley
Reply with quote
Post 
Shaos wrote:
...этот топик про КР580ВМ80А (коих у меня 8 штук не считая пятерых i8080 ; )

P.S. Надо чтоли на макетке простой стенд собрать для проверки этих процов - а то из них пара дырявых:

Image

на вышеозначенной фотке процыков только 7, т.к. восьмой стоит в нерабочей РК-шке:

Image


Вот наконец сфоткал последние свои приобретения:

Image

Пару чёрный 580 и белый 580 купил только ради белого

А вот это ЗАВОДСКАЯ упаковка 24 микропроцессоров КР580ВМ80А с мануалом-"этикеткой":

Image

Image

Image

Image

Этикетка кликабельная!

P.S. т.е. теперь у меня 34 микропроцессора КР580ВМ80А (не считая оригинальных i8080)

_________________
:dj: https://mastodon.social/@Shaos


11 Dec 2012 21:54
Profile WWW
Senior
User avatar

Joined: 09 Aug 2012 11:20
Posts: 176
Location: 95.135.174.189
Reply with quote
Post 
Может я чего недопонял, или криво посмотрел, но мне кажется, там приоритетный доступ к шине! :-?

_________________
Хочу стать всезнайкой ;-)


13 Dec 2012 09:27
Profile
God

Joined: 02 Jan 2006 02:28
Posts: 1390
Location: Abakan
Reply with quote
Post 
Именно прозрачный, как бы сказал ВВП - транспарентный. Т.е. когда каждый проц, работая в полную силу без тормозов, не подозревает, что к памяти имеют доступ еще 4 штуки таких же как он.
Грубо говоря, заходя на склад, ты не столкнёшься нос к носу ни с одним из еще 4 присутствующих кладовщиков, при этом заходить туда можешь в любое удобное для тебя время, и никто тебя на входе не тормознёт. Остальные 4 кладовщика работают так же, и даже не подозревают о наличии как тебя, так и остальных кроме себя.


13 Dec 2012 09:38
Profile
Display posts from previous:  Sort by  
Reply to topic   [ 413 posts ]  Go to page Previous  1 ... 21, 22, 23, 24, 25, 26, 27, 28  Next

Who is online

Users browsing this forum: No registered users and 22 guests


You cannot post new topics in this forum
You cannot reply to topics in this forum
You cannot edit your posts in this forum
You cannot delete your posts in this forum
You cannot post attachments in this forum

Search for:
Jump to:  
Powered by phpBB® Forum Software © phpBB Group
Designed by ST Software.